Natural Product Identification
Common NameBE-18591
Provided ByNPAtlasNPAtlas Logo
Description BE-18591 is found in Streptomyces. BE-18591 was first documented in 1993 (PMID: 8294236). Based on a literature review very few articles have been published on dodecyl({4-methoxy-1H,1'H-[2,2'-bipyrrole]-5-yl}methylidene)amine.

Chemical FormulaC22H35N3O
Average Mass357.5420 Da
Monoisotopic Mass357.27801 Da
IUPAC Name(E)-dodecyl({4-methoxy-1H,1'H-[2,2'-bipyrrole]-5-yl}methylidene)amine
Traditional Name(E)-dodecyl({4-methoxy-1H,1'H-[2,2'-bipyrrole]-5-yl}methylidene)amine
CAS Registry NumberNot Available
SMILES
CCCCCCCCCCCCN=CC1=C(OC)C=C(N1)C1=CC=CN1
InChI Identifier
InChI=1S/C22H35N3O/c1-3-4-5-6-7-8-9-10-11-12-15-23-18-21-22(26-2)17-20(25-21)19-14-13-16-24-19/h13-14,16-18,24-25H,3-12,15H2,1-2H3
InChI KeyYGDMZCDTTXTBHS-UHFFFAOYSA-N
